Which Bag Do You Think Is Superior: a Tote Bag or a Handbag?

The debate between tote bags and handbags is more than just fashion—it’s about lifestyle, functionality, and personal values. Both have earned loyal followings, but which one is truly superior? The answer may depend on what you prioritize most in your daily life.
1. Tote Bag: Spacious and Practical
Tote bags are loved for their roomy design and versatility. They can carry laptops, books, gym clothes, or even groceries, making them perfect for students, professionals, or busy parents. Many are lightweight, eco-friendly, and often reusable, which adds to their appeal.
-
Best for: daily commutes, shopping, school, or casual outings.
-
Strengths: large capacity, sustainability, affordability.
-
Drawbacks: less structured, fewer compartments, not ideal for formal events.
2. Handbag: Elegant and Stylish
Handbags, especially structured ones, are seen as symbols of elegance and status. They often come with multiple compartments, offering better organization for smaller essentials like wallets, phones, and cosmetics. Luxury handbags in particular can even serve as investments.
-
Best for: work meetings, dinners, formal occasions.
-
Strengths: stylish design, organizational features, prestige.
-
Drawbacks: smaller capacity, often heavier, usually more expensive.
3. Lifestyle Considerations
The “superior” choice depends on your daily routine:
-
If you’re constantly on the move and need space, the tote is the clear winner.
-
If you want sophistication and structure, the handbag is hard to beat.
This leads to a deeper question: should bags be chosen for functionality or for identity?
4. Sustainability vs. Luxury Value
Tote bags often emphasize sustainability—with eco-friendly materials like canvas, jute, or recycled fabrics. Handbags, on the other hand, emphasize craftsmanship and luxury value, sometimes becoming heirlooms or investment pieces. The decision reflects whether you prioritize eco-conscious living or timeless luxury.

So, which is superior: a tote bag or a handbag? The truth is, neither is universally better—it depends on what you carry, how you live, and what you value. Perhaps the best answer is not to choose one over the other, but to own both, using each in the right context.
